The Forest Maze isn’t terribly long, but there are only two correct ways to pass through it. Trying to follow anything but those two will lead you right back to the maze’s entrance.

How To Follow Geno Through The Maze

You are only required to pass through the maze once. After Geno comes to life, he will immediately depart for the forest. You need to follow him there. And once you reach the forest's maze, you need to play an impromptu game of “follow the leader” with him so you can copy the route he takes through it.

The maze is made up of six nearly identical screens. Each has an open center area and four exits. The only significant changes are the types and quantities of enemies that dwell in them. You can avoid or fight the enemies as you make your way through the maze.

Again, the way you reach the maze is by following Geno. But, if you lose track of which exit he took, you can use the chart below to figure out which one it was. All you need to do is make sure you know which screen you’re currently on.

Screen

Exit

1

Southeast

2

Northeast

3

Northeast

4

Southeast

5

Northeast

6

Northwest

After passing through the sixth exit, you’ll reach the end of the maze. This is where you’ll finally meet Geno. It’s also where you team up with him and fight the area’s boss, Bowyer.

How To Find The Maze’s Hidden Treasure

The second reason you’d want to explore the Forest Maze is to find some extra treasure. To find this route, you’ll first need to help the Toad, who has been locked out of his home in Rose Town. You can find him standing next to the cliff his house is on in the northern part of town.

Jump on top of his head and then jump to reach his home. Go inside and then up the stairs to find his son and a green switch. Jump on the switch to make some stairs leading from the ground outside to his home appear.

When you go outside, he will come up the steps and enter his home. Follow him back inside and speak with him again. At this point, he will show his thanks by telling you a secret route you can follow in the Forest Maze to find the secret area.

Return to the start of the maze and follow the route he told you to find a number of chests that contain goodies such as Mushrooms, Flowers to max out FP and a Frog Coin.

Screen

Exit

1

Northwest

2

Southwest

3

Southwest

4

Northwest
